WebAlso called leiomyomas (lie-o-my-O-muhs) or myomas, uterine fibroids aren't associated with an increased risk of uterine cancer and almost never develop into cancer. Fibroids range in size from seedlings, undetectable by the human eye, to bulky masses that can distort and enlarge the uterus. You can have a single fibroid or multiple ones. WebOct 19, 2024 · The ovaries are firm and ovoid in shape and measure approximately 1.5-3.0 cm × 1.5-3.0 cm × 1.0-2.0 cm (length x width x thickness) (corresponding to a volume of 1.2-9.4 cm 3 ). For more on ovarian volume, see: Ovarian size and volume. An ovary typically weighs 2-8 g, however, they change during life and double in size in pregnancy. Polycystic ovary syndrome is a condition that affects women in their child-bearing years and alters the levels of multiple hormones, resulting in problems affecting … WebJan 12, 2024 · Ovaries are the small organs on either side of the uterus where eggs are produced. During ovulation, a follicle is formed, which is a cyst-like structure. Once the follicle matures, it will rupture, and an egg will be released. The ruptured follicle then becomes a corpus luteum, which will dissolve.
